DC Budgam chairs 13th NCORD meeting; reviews measures against drug menace

Budgam, July 17: The Deputy Commissioner (DC) Budgam, Akshay Labroo on Monday conducted the 13th meeting of District Level Committee of Narco Coordination Centre (NCORD) at Conference Hall of the DC Office Complex, here to take review of the action taken by the concerned departments with regard to decisions made in previous meetings.
The future course of action to uproot the drug menace and destruction of Narco crops from Budgam District was also formulated during the meeting.
 At the outset, the DC took detailed feedback from every concerned Department regarding the measures undertaken for combating illicit trafficking of narcotic drugs and psychotropic substances, and its consumption in the district to save youth from the dangerous effects of the drugs.
The DC said that drug abuse is a serious problem that not only affects individuals, but also families and communities. He stated that it is essential to tackle the issue from multiple perspectives, including deterrence, treatment and enforcement.
He reiterated that the District Administration is committed to create a drug-free environment in the district and will continue to take all necessary steps to achieve this goal. 
On the occasion, the DC directed Assistant Drug Controller Budgam to install CCTV camera in the drug stores and achieve 100% saturation. He also directed Excise Officer to ensure coordination with Revenue and police departments at sub-division level for imposing greater deterrence to combat dangerous trade of drug-trafficking, destruction of poppy and cannabis cultivation in the district.
He said that efforts with Cooperation, Coordination and Collaboration are vital to contain the drug peddling and break the supply chain, besides taking stringent action against the culprits involved in the hazardous trade of drugs, and cultivation in narco crops.
He further directed Excise Officer to initiate legal paperworks in Police Stations on regular basis whenever there is destruction of any poppy or cannabis cultivation in the District.
The DC said there should be 100% geotagging of destroyed cultivation and all the land under cultivation of poppy or cannabis be geo-tagged.
He directed DSWO to complete all the formalities with regard to functioning of Drug de-addiction centre Budgam  so that the same is used for  proper counselling and rehabilitation of individuals struggling with addiction.
Akshay stressed that pro-active awareness be  initiated on wider levels at Schools, Colleges, markets and at all busy public places to sensitize students and common masses about ill effects of drugs as well as encouraging healthy activities and hobbies to discourage the drug abuse.
The DC directed all SDMs and SDPOs to involve religious scholars and imams of masjids at high scale who will deliver their sermons against drug abuse during Friday prayers.
With regard to enforcement efforts, the DC said District Administration  will ensure zero tolerance policy against drugs abuse and  serious action will be taken against those involved in drug trafficking and smuggling, 
The DC said the drug menace is a major threat to the socio-economic structure and it has become imperative for the entire society to come together to uproot this menace and work as a strong entity to make Budgam a healthy and drugs free District.
During the meeting, SSP Budgam Al-Tahir Gilani talked about the overall scenario of drug abuse in district and measures taken to curb the menace.
He threw light on various dimensions related to drug abuse and its peddling network and ways to break the chain.
